logo

Output 608d3e156d52e6dcd19779ee5df6180eb7d793ec56929e8ee5064e03ae721de5:1

value
2700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 351569dde5b186973b81c647a69cf469876347ac OP_EQUAL
address
36XhPYqdrMorqzv96F7znrQvyTSKWyMrwK
transaction
608d3e156d52e6dcd19779ee5df6180eb7d793ec56929e8ee5064e03ae721de5